Mysql 架构及优化之-定时计划任务
概论
mysql计划任务可以定时更新数据库表或者做大文件的汇总表
配置
开启计划任务
SHOW VARIABLES LIKE 'event_scheduler'
查看是否开启 off 表示未开启
set global event_scheduler =1
此次重启之后的mysql器件生效
永久生效
可见已经开启
语法体
create event myevent on schedule at current_timestamp + interval 1 hour (周期或者时间点) do update myschema.mytable set mycol = mycol + 1; (执行的sql)
周期或者时间点语法
每1秒执行
on schedule every 1 second
10天后执行
on schedule at current_timestamp + interval 10 day
指定日期时间执行
on schedule at timestamp '2016-08-16 00:00:00'
每天凌晨3点执行
on schedule every 1 day
starts '2016-05-18 03:00:00'
(设定从第二天凌晨3点开始)
每天定时执行,5天后停止执行
on schedule every 1 day
ends current_timestamp + interval 5 day
5天后开启每天定时清空test表,一个月后停止执行
on schedule every 1 day
starts current_timestamp + interval 5 day
ends current_timestamp + interval 1 month
高级用法
执行多条sql
delimiter | create event B on schedule every 1 second comment '计划任务注释' do begin insert into smudge.fruit value ('banana'); insert into smudge.fruit value ('apple'); end | delimiter ;
临时关闭事件
alter event smudge_insert disable;
临时开启事件
alter event smudge_insert enable;
删除计划任务
drop event smudge_insert;
Mysql 架构及优化之-定时计划任务相关推荐
- mysql schedule every_Mysql 架构及优化之-定时计划任务
概论 mysql计划任务可以定时更新数据库表或者做大文件的汇总表 配置 开启计划任务 SHOW VARIABLES LIKE 'event_scheduler' 查看是否开启 off 表示未开启 se ...
- 数mysql据分析优化_从零开始学习数据分析-mysql架构与优化理论
mysql的逻辑分层:连接层 服务层 引擎层 存储层 引擎层主要分为两类:InnoDB.MyIsam(使用show engines;查看) InnoDB是事务优先的,会进行行锁,适合高并发操作 MyI ...
- Mysql 架构及优化之-索引优化
索引基础知识 索引帮助mysql高效获取数据的数据结构 索引(mysql中叫"键(key)") 数据越大越重要 索引好比一本书,为了找到书中特定的话题,查看目录,获得页码 sele ...
- MySQL 数据存储和优化------MySQL架构原理 ---- (架构---索引---事务---锁---集群---性能---分库分表---实战---运维)持续更新
Mysql架构体系全系列文章主目录(进不去说明还没写完)https://blog.csdn.net/grd_java/article/details/123033016 本文只是整个系列笔记的第一章: ...
- 【建议收藏】15755字,讲透MySQL性能优化(包含MySQL架构、存储引擎、调优工具、SQL、索引、建议等等)
0. 目录 1)MySQL总体架构介绍 2)MySQL存储引擎调优 3)常用慢查询分析工具 4)如何定位不合理的SQL 5)SQL优化的一些建议 1 MySQL总体架构介绍 1.1 MySQL总体架构 ...
- Mysql使用大全(MySQL架构与存储引擎 、事务 、业务设计 、索引 、数据结构 、执行计划 、数值类型)
这是一篇mysql大全,学习完这篇文章,相信在日常业务和面试完全不在问题,下面我们来一一介绍 MySQL架构与存储引擎 全局变量和会话变量 要想显式指定是否设置全局或会话变量,使用GLOBAL或SES ...
- Mysql(五)Mysql架构、数据库优化、主从复制
文章目录 一.Mysql架构 1.1 查询语句的执行过程 1.1.1 连接器 1.1.2 查询缓存 1.1.3 分析器 1.1.4 优化器 1.1.5 执行器 1.1.6 存储引擎 1.1.7 执行引 ...
- 【建议收藏】15755 字,讲透 MySQL 性能优化(包含 MySQL 架构、存储引擎、调优工具、SQL、索引、建议等等)
0. 目录 1)MySQL 总体架构介绍 2)MySQL 存储引擎调优 3)常用慢查询分析工具 4)如何定位不合理的 SQL 5)SQL 优化的一些建议 1 MySQL 总体架构介绍 1.1 MySQ ...
- mysql 执行计划 优化_执行计划
#### 概念 一个sql语句在没有执行(运行)之前,先计算一下该sql语句需要调用的相关资源,再决定该sql语句是否要最终执行,该行为被称为"执行计划". #### 作用 主要用 ...
最新文章
- 计蒜客 神奇的二叉树 ( 已知先序和中序遍历构建二叉树 )
- Vivado中用于时钟操作的几个Tcl命令
- ndarray.shape[]返回值的意义
- C++默认参数与函数重载
- 【案例分享】无线唤醒技术在灌溉系统上的应用案例
- linux 下的文件属性,Linux 下文件属性介绍(示例代码)
- Unity Shader:Waveform波形(1)-用正弦函数做闪烁效果并分析波形公式中的参数
- 智能家居落地还有多远?
- surf中,颜色描述第四维
- 【渝粤教育】国家开放大学2018年秋季 0579-22T电路及磁路(2)(一) 参考试题
- Tp 引入 simple_html_dom.php
- html5酷狗音乐网页代码,酷狗音乐
- c语言程序设计第五版第四章例题
- 【教育心理学】学习理论流派——行为主义学习理论
- thymeleaf中三元运算符嵌套写法
- 2021年中式面点师(中级)最新解析及中式面点师(中级)模拟考试题库
- 冰柱图分析:学习笔记
- 20145325张梓靖 《网络对抗技术》 Web安全基础实践
- QCTF - re -babyre(Rust逆向)
- 【Ubuntu】更新系统时间
热门文章
- 把一台Cisco路由器配置为帧中继交换机
- PowerDesigner的样式设置
- 【Scala-spark.mlib】稠密矩阵和稀疏矩阵的创建及操作
- pythonexcel介绍_Python 中pandas.read_excel详细介绍
- Python发展迅猛,如何在Python热中脱颖而出了?
- 当你用Python爬取网站遇到反爬,你应该这样做,轻松解决反爬问题
- Python夺冠,老牌编程语言该走向何方?网友:崩溃
- python 守护线程 join_Python多线程threading join和守护线程setDeamon原理详解
- linux redis 设置日志,linux上redis怎么动态看日志
- 分享一个让 Ping 的输出更简单易读方法